## Dependency Pinning Policy

When reviewing pull requests for the Larkspur build system, verify that every dependency in the manifest is pinned to an exact version, not a range. Floating versions have caused two unreproducible builds this quarter, so treat any caret or tilde specifier as a blocking issue. Lockfile updates must be isolated in their own commit with a short justification. If a transitive pin conflict seems unavoidable, pause the review and contact the platform stewards first.

escalation mailbox, hahof-fahag: istwyn.prawyn@qirvanlabs.internal

/*
 * Fixture: dns_flaky_resolver_case
 *
 * Plugin authors: this fixture simulates the intermittent DNS failures we
 * see against the Harrowmead resolver pool. Roughly 1 in 20 lookups for
 * *.plugins.veldt.test returns NXDOMAIN before succeeding on retry, so
 * your plugin must tolerate a single failed resolution without crashing
 * the host process. The mock registry requires auth even in test mode;
 * requests should carry the token given below.
 */

session JWT of yawep-yawep = eyJhbGciOiJIUzI1NiIsInR5cCI6IkpXVCJ9.eyJzdWIiOiI3pWF3_In0.aXYsHiog

## Onboarding: Retention Sweeper (Project Quillbarrow)

The Quillbarrow sweeper purges expired records nightly from the Larchfield cluster, honoring per-table retention windows defined in sweep-policy.yaml. Before your first release, verify the dry-run report matches the policy file; discrepancies must be escalated to the data stewardship channel before any destructive pass runs. The sweeper authenticates to the audit vault using a service credential that must never be committed to the repo. Add the following line to your .env.release file now.

vault entry, kagep-yajeg: COURIER_KEY5=da097

Runbook: restarting Pickaroo, our pick-list optimizer. If routes look scrambled, first flush the aisle-graph cache — nine times out of ten that's it. Then bounce the solver pod and watch the Denholm warehouse queue drain. Ping Rasha if it doesn't clear in five minutes. When filing an incident, quote the token below.

pipeline stamp: htk31_f769b577b3028a4e9958e5bb8d1259a